He’s done it! Tom Cruise has proposed to girlfriend Katie Holmes, officially putting the publicity machine that is their whirlwind romance into overdrive. The "War of the Worlds" star, in Paris to promote his upcoming alien action flick, announced the couple’s engagement at a press conference Friday morning. According to Cruise, he popped the question atop the world’s most famous landmark (the Eiffel Tower) in the world’s most romantic city (Paris, bien sûr).

And finally, if you’re looking for an original gift idea for a celeb-obsessed friend, look no further than the Next Big Thing: Celebrity Air. An enterprising Los Angeles writer and his chiropractor friend, under the moniker "The Celebrity Air Collection Squad," are auctioning off a mason jar of air captured at the Westwood premiere of "Mr. and Mrs. Smith." According to the Ebay listing, the jar contains "the same air molecules that were zipping around those in attendance" and was sealed as Angelina Jolie and Brad Pitt strolled by down the red carpet. Sound like a crock to you? Bidding on the current Celebrity Jar is creeping past $100, and counting.
